Andreas Metzler <[email protected]> wrote: [...] > this also fails for me on up to date Debian/unstable *without* Nvidia > stuff if I am using -Wl,--as-needed.
> mkdir build-dir > cd build-dir && cmake -DCMAKE_INSTALL_PREFIX=/usr > -DCMAKE_EXE_LINKER_FLAGS="-Wl,--as-needed -Wl,-z,defs" > -DCMAKE_MODULE_LINKER_FLAGS="-Wl,--as-needed -Wl,-z,defs" > -DCMAKE_SHARED_LINKER_FLAGS="-Wl,--as-needed -Wl,-z,defs" .. [...] I should have read more diligently, the error I am describing is slightly different than the one noted before (undefined reference to GLUT) mine is about libGL and libGLEW: cd /tmp/HUGIN/hugin-2009.2.0/build-dir/src/hugin_base && /usr/bin/cmake -E cmake_link_script CMakeFiles/huginbase.dir/link.txt --verbose=1 /usr/lib/ccache/c++ -fPIC -g -O2 -O2 -g -Wl,--as-needed -Wl,-z,defs -shared -Wl,-soname,libhuginbase.so.0.0 -o libhuginbase.so.0.0 CMakeFiles/huginbase.dir/algorithms/nona/NonaFileStitcher.cpp.o [...] CMakeFiles/huginbase.dir/vigra_ext/ImageTransformsGPU.cpp.o -lboost_thread-mt ../foreign/levmar/libhuginlevmar.a ../foreign/vigra/vigra_impex/libhuginvigraimpex.so.0.0 -lboost_thread-mt -lexiv2 -lpano13 -ltiff -ljpeg -lImath -lIlmImf -lIex -lHalf -lIlmThread -lpng -lz -ltiff -Wl,-rpath,/tmp/HUGIN/hugin-2009.2.0/build-dir/src/foreign/vigra/vigra_impex CMakeFiles/huginbase.dir/vigra_ext/ImageTransformsGPU.cpp.o: In function `checkFramebufferStatus': /tmp/HUGIN/hugin-2009.2.0/src/hugin_base/vigra_ext/ImageTransformsGPU.cpp:135: undefined reference to `__glewCheckFramebufferStatusEXT' [...] CMakeFiles/huginbase.dir/vigra_ext/ImageTransformsGPU.cpp.o: In function `makeChunks': /tmp/HUGIN/hugin-2009.2.0/src/hugin_base/vigra_ext/ImageTransformsGPU.cpp:234: undefined reference to `glTexImage2D' /tmp/HUGIN/hugin-2009.2.0/src/hugin_base/vigra_ext/ImageTransformsGPU.cpp:236: undefined reference to `glGetTexLevelParameteriv' [loads of similar errors.] cu andreas --~--~---------~--~----~------------~-------~--~----~ You received this message because you are subscribed to the Google Groups "hugin and other free panoramic software" group. A list of frequently asked questions is available at: http://wiki.panotools.org/Hugin_FAQ To post to this group, send email to [email protected] To unsubscribe from this group, send email to [email protected] For more options, visit this group at http://groups.google.com/group/hugin-ptx -~----------~----~----~----~------~----~------~--~---
